Good looking fish, those oceangoing Cod you describe.

We cook a lot of Cod on the grill in the Boots' household; short marinade in olive oil, kosher salt, splashes of lemon and white wine, and some good garlic lemon pepper, then off to the grill until flakey. F-A-B as the Thunderbirds used to say. Serve with a crisp white wine. I call it the poor man's Sea Bass.

Also great pan-seared fast in a cast iron skillet (aren't all great skillets cast iron? They should find the guy who invented non-stick and bury him up to his neck in an antbed).

Oh. Thats a new complex they are building. It's called snow. Opens next year. I really look forward to it.

It will be 4 downhill slopes. 2 km of crosscountry track. 8 skilifts including a Chairlift. All inside a building of 538000 sq.feet. open year long.

It will be really cool. 15 min. From my home.
